Pro W6800X has a 433.3% higher maximum VRAM amount.

RTX 4050 Max-Q, on the other hand, has an age advantage of 1 year, a 40% more advanced lithography process, and 471.4% lower power consumption.

We couldn't decide between Radeon Pro W6800X and GeForce RTX 4050 Max-Q. We've got no test results to judge.

Be aware that Radeon Pro W6800X is a workstation graphics card while GeForce RTX 4050 Max-Q is a notebook one.
